Who are we? Hawaiian Host Group (HHG) is a leading Hawai‘i-based consumer goods company with a portfolio of brands that includes Hawaiian Host®, Mauna Loa®, MacFarms®, KOHO®, and Royal Hawaiian Orchards®. Sold in over 23 countries, HHG produces a suite of products ranging from flavored macadamia nuts to artisan chocolates, and macadamia milk-based ice cream. Our dedicated team of Hosts of Hawai‘i is spread across its headquarters in Honolulu and offices in Hilo, Kona, Los Angeles, and Tokyo. HHG has manufacturing plants in Honolulu and Kea‘au, as well as Hawai‘i’s largest single macadamia farm.
